sambal salsa & black bean tacos
 
 
Serves: makes about 1.5 cup of salsa, enough for about 5 tacos
Ingredients
for the salsa:
  • 2-3 tomatoes, diced
  • 1 clove of garlic, minced
  • ¼ cup diced red onion
  • ¼ cup chopped green onions
  • juice & zest of 2 small limes
  • 1-2 teaspoons sambal chile paste
  • ½ teaspoon olive oil
  • salt & pepper
  • ½ teaspoon ginger, minced (optional)
  • pinch of sugar or a tiny bit of honey (optional)
  • chopped avocado
for the tacos:'
  • tortillas
  • black beans
  • cotija cheese (optional)
  • serve with extra limes
Instructions
  1. Mix all salsa ingredients together. Let it sit for at least 15 minutes for the flavors to come together. Taste and adjust seasonings.
  2. Mix in chopped avocado just before serving. (taste & adjust again).
  3. Assemble tacos with black beans, salsa, and crumbly cheese (if using). Serve with extra limes.
Notes
You can find sambal in the asian section of most grocery stores.

Pictured are sprouted corn tortillas, which are vegan and gluten free. If you're gf, check the labels of your tortillas, not all corn tortillas are gluten free.
